Loại bìa: Bìa mềm NỘI DUNG: Join the Big Bad Wolf as he debunks your favorite fairy tales with SCIENCE!

Written by the hilarious Catherine Cawthorne and illustrated by award-winning Sara Ogilvie, this witty and entertaining book challenges beloved fairy tales with a scientific twist.

Did a princess really feel a tiny pea through a mountain of mattresses? Could a pumpkin really turn into a carriage to carry Cinderella to the ball? Of course not! It’s all a load of fairytale NONSENSE! Or is it…?

The Big Bad Wolf is on a mission to uncover the truth behind these tales, all while trying to clear his name. Combining STEM topics with classic stories children know and love, this hilarious non-fiction picture book is perfect for inquisitive minds who are always asking big questions!
